I have done the fan trickery in a $51 tune and it worked fine. The problem is the definition for $76 is not available is it? If there was one it would be no problem. How do I go about setting up a xdf file for the $76. I would like a good definition file so I can play around with various settings later.

Re: $76A VS LPG input pin

Posted: Tue May 08, 2012 2:36 pm
by VL400
Would need to use a hex editor looking at both bin files and comparing them to each other. Using the $51 XDF as your address guide, find the item in a $51 bin and then look for the same data in the $76 bin - thats all I did to work out the VATS flag. Its time consuming!

by yoda69
Attached is an excel file with an extract (from $2000 to $6000) of a number of $51 and $76 files side by side. I find this method easiest to use when comparing similar files rather than a Hex Editor.

As a guide, I've started with the following to give you an idea.
1. Program ID Code at $2008
2. Option Flags for $51 are at $3818/9, and for $76 at $381B/C
3. Malfunction Flags appear the same starting at $35E2 for both $51 and $76
4. Main Spark High Octane, $51 Variants A-E start at $382E, Variant F at $382F, and $76 at $3832

Typically if the values look the same, or majority are the same it is too much of a coincidence to be different. Doing this all relies on the $51 xdf you are using being correct, which being done by The1 is a fairly good chance.
I would suggest initially look through the $51 xdf and identify the scalars/flags/tables you want to change and find these first in $76, as this is a very time consuming process, so good luck, and make sure you post the XDF up when you're finished for others.
